Apply for a K-1 Visa to Bring Your Fiancé(e) to Braselton, GA

Known as the fiancé(e) visa, the K-1 visa provides a single-entry to the U.S. intended to facilitate your marriage in Braselton, GA. It lets a U.S. citizen's foreign-born fiancé(e) enter the country, on the condition that they marry within 90 days of entry. To qualify for this visa, you and your fiancé(e) need to have met in person within the past two years and prove a bona fide, ongoing relationship.

If USCIS approves your fiancé(e)’s K-1 visa application, they will visit a U.S. embassy or consulate in their home country to attend a visa interview and be granted the visa. They will be asked to prove the legitimacy of your relationship and provide the necessary documents. After your fiancé(e) is granted entry into the U.S. and you marry, you can petition for their permanent residence in Braselton, GA to become a lawful permanent resident of the United States, also known as a “green card”.

K-3 Visas for Spouses of U.S. Citizens in Braselton, GA

With the K-3 visa, foreign-citizen spouses of United States citizens can temporarily enter the country while waiting for their immigration visa petitions to be approved. This visa enables your significant other to come and live with you in Braselton, GA during the time their immigrant visa application is being adjudicated.

To apply for the K-3 visa, the person must be in a legal marriage with a U.S. citizen and have already sent United States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) supporting documents and form I-130, Petition for Alien Relative. After being approved for a K-3 visa and arriving in Braselton, GA, your spouse can pursue a work permit and permanent residency in the U.S.

Many choose the K-3 visa to avoid prolonged separations caused by I-130 processing delays. Though the K-3 process is sometimes slightly faster, the visa holder must still undergo a permanent resident application after they've arrived into the USA.. Furthermore, if the I-130 gets approved in the interim, the consulate may process the immigrant visa instead.
